Cleverse, Expands in Vietnam... "License Agreement Continues"

Cleverse announced on the 1st that it has signed a new license agreement to export English curriculum and textbook IP with XGENIUS ENGLISH, a local education company in Vietnam. With this, Cleverse has achieved the milestone of exporting its own IP to Vietnam for the third time in 2024.


In June of this year, Cleverse secured two export contracts to Vietnam. The first contract involved entering the offline public education sector and private education market throughout Vietnam with English brands such as Kienguru, Chungdam Language Institute, and April. The second contract was for exporting the V-Hoc and CMS math curriculum and textbook IP.


EduLabs is a startup established in Vietnam in 2024, but its management team consists of prominent figures in the Vietnamese education industry. It has already secured investments from venture capitalists (VCs), and ahead of its full-scale offline expansion starting in July, it signed a contract with Cleverse, which has already been proven successful in Vietnam.


Meanwhile, Cleverse plans to open about 20 branches across Vietnam in cooperation with EduLabs in the second half of the year, starting with classes for preschool and elementary students in the Hanoi area.


Lee Dong-hoon, CEO of Cleverse, said, “We have secured not only offline channels such as public and private education in Vietnam but also online channels. Through continued partnerships with local Vietnamese education companies, Cleverse will overcome regional limitations and use its solid market share monopoly and successful track records in both Korea and Vietnam as a stepping stone to strengthen its position in the global market.”
